Why Garage Door Maintenance Matters
Your garage door moves up and down roughly 1,400 times per year. That's thousands of cycles wearing on springs, rollers, cables, and hinges. Without regular inspection and lubrication, parts fail faster, and one broken component can cascade into bigger problems.
Here's what I've seen time and again: a homeowner ignores squeaking noises for months, then suddenly the door gets stuck halfway up. Now they're looking at an emergency call instead of a routine maintenance visit. The cost difference is substantial. A preventive tune-up might run $150 to $200. An emergency repair after something snaps? Often double or triple that, depending on what failed.
Springs, for example, last 7 to 9 years under normal use with proper maintenance. Skip the lubrication and inspections, and you might get only 5 or 6 years. That's money left on the table.
What a Garage Door Tune-Up Includes
A professional tune-up covers several critical areas. First, lubrication. I use a light machine oil on the rollers, hinges, and tracks. Not WD-40, which dries out and collects dirt. Proper lubricant reduces friction and keeps the door operating quietly and smoothly.
Next, inspection. I look at the springs for signs of wear or corrosion, check that cables aren't fraying, and verify the door is balanced. An unbalanced door puts extra strain on the opener and wears parts faster. I also inspect the weatherstripping and seals, especially here in Cerritos where salt air from the coast can degrade rubber faster than inland areas.

How Often Should You Schedule Maintenance?
I recommend an annual tune-up, ideally in spring before the busy summer season. If you use your garage door heavily (multiple times daily for a business, for example), twice yearly isn't overkill.
Watch for warning signs between appointments. Squeaking, grinding sounds, or a door that moves slowly all warrant a call. If you're unsure whether something needs attention, our troubleshooting guide covers common problems and warning signs to help you decide if it's urgent.
For most residential customers, scheduling maintenance in March or April makes sense. You avoid the rush of emergency calls in summer when heat expands metal and demand spikes, and you catch small issues before they become costly repairs.

Can I maintain my garage door myself? You can clean tracks and apply light lubrication, but professional inspection requires specialized knowledge. Springs and cables are under extreme tension and dangerous to service without proper training. Leave those to the pros.
What happens if I skip regular maintenance? Parts wear faster and fail sooner, leading to costly emergency repairs. A neglected door may also become a safety hazard if sensors or auto-reverse systems aren't inspected and tested regularly.
How long does a maintenance appointment take? Most tune-ups take 30 to 45 minutes. We'll inspect, lubricate, test safety systems, and discuss any concerns or damage we find, all in one visit.
